Hash Generator Online

Generate MD5, SHA-1, SHA-256, and SHA-512 hashes from text or files online. 100% browser-based — no data is sent to any server.

All hashing happens in your browser using the Web Crypto API. No data is sent to any server.
MD5-
SHA-1-
SHA-256-
SHA-512-

Hash a File

Compare Hashes

How to generate a hash

  1. Enter text in the input field — hashes update as you type.
  2. Or upload a file to compute its checksum hash.
  3. Copy any hash — MD5, SHA-1, SHA-256, or SHA-512 — with one click.
  4. Use the compare tool to verify if two hashes match.

Hash algorithm comparison

Need more tools?

Browse our collection of free developer tools.

Browse All Tools →